On 5/5/12 8:02 PM, Robert Vineyard wrote:
Daemonlogger is a packet logger and soft tap developed by Martin Roesch.
This patch adds a Makefile to build it as an OpenWRT ipk package.

Note: the patch is against trunk, but it also builds cleanly on Backfire.

Signed-off-by: Robert Vineyard<viney...@tuffmail.com>

---

Index: feeds/packages/net/daemonlogger/Makefile
===================================================================
--- feeds/packages/net/daemonlogger/Makefile    (revision 0)
+++ feeds/packages/net/daemonlogger/Makefile    (revision 0)
@@ -0,0 +1,49 @@
+#
+# Copyright (C) 2007-2011 OpenWrt.org
+#
+# This is free software, licensed under the GNU General Public License v2.
+# See /LICENSE for more information.
+#
+
+include $(TOPDIR)/rules.mk
+
+PKG_NAME:=daemonlogger
+PKG_VERSION:=1.2.1
+PKG_RELEASE:=1
+
+PKG_SOURCE:=463
+PKG_SOURCE_URL:=http://www.snort.org/downloads/
+PKG_CAT:=zcat
+PKG_MD5SUM:=acb64aa6cd5777e297569f100b5c39ee
+
+PKG_BUILD_DIR:=$(BUILD_DIR)/$(PKG_NAME)/$(PKG_NAME)-$(PKG_VERSION)
+
+PKG_INSTALL:=1
+
+include $(INCLUDE_DIR)/package.mk
+
+define Package/daemonlogger
+  SECTION:=net
+  CATEGORY:=Network
+  DEPENDS:=+libpcap
+  DEPENDS:=+libdnet

Please combine these on a single line...


+  TITLE:=Software Network Tap
+  URL:=http://www.snort.org/snort-downloads/additional-downloads
+endef
+
+CONFIGURE_VARS += \
+       BUILD_CC="$(TARGET_CC)" \
+       HOSTCC="$(HOSTCC)"
+
+MAKE_FLAGS := CCOPT="$(TARGET_CFLAGS)" INCLS="-I. $(TARGET_CPPFLAGS)"
+
+define Build/Configure
+       $(call Build/Configure/Default)
+endef

I think this is the default, isn't it?


+
+define Package/daemonlogger/install
+       $(INSTALL_DIR) $(1)/usr/bin
+       $(INSTALL_BIN) $(PKG_INSTALL_DIR)/usr/bin/daemonlogger $(1)/usr/bin/
+endef
+
+$(eval $(call BuildPackage,daemonlogger))
